Steps to Publish an Obituary in Sun Journal Newspaper
Publishing an obituary in the Sun Journal newspaper is a straightforward process that can be completed either online or through direct contact with the newspaper. Below are the steps to guide you through this process:
Contacting the Newspaper
Begin by contacting the Sun Journal directly. You can do this via their website or by calling their customer service department. They will provide you with the necessary information and forms to complete the publication process.
Preparing the Obituary
Before submitting your obituary, ensure that it includes all relevant information about the deceased, such as their full name, date of birth, date of passing, and any significant life events or achievements. Personal messages from family members can also be included to make the obituary more meaningful.

Tips for Writing a Meaningful Obituary
Writing an obituary can be a heartfelt and meaningful experience. Here are some tips to help you craft a tribute that truly honors the life of the deceased:
- Begin with the basic details: full name, date of birth, and date of passing.
- Include personal achievements and contributions to the community.
- Mention surviving family members and their relationships to the deceased.
- Use a respectful and dignified tone throughout the obituary.
- Consider adding a personal message or favorite quote from the deceased.
Preserving Obituaries for Future Generations
Preserving Sun Journal newspaper obituaries is essential for ensuring that the memories of loved ones are passed down through generations. Whether through physical copies or digital archives, there are several ways to safeguard these important records.
Physical Copies
Storing physical copies of obituaries in a safe and organized manner can help preserve them for years to come. Consider using acid-free paper and protective sleeves to prevent deterioration over time.
Digital Archiving
Digital archiving offers a convenient and long-lasting solution for preserving obituaries. Many online platforms allow you to upload and store obituaries securely, ensuring that they remain accessible to future generations.
